Baby Perl Las is a champion cheese, with everything you want in a blue! Strong, tangy, salty and organic ~ delicious! Made by the Adams family at the Caws Cenarth Dairy in Wales. Perl Las differs from other blue cheeses because the first taste is of rich creaminess, followed by the saltiness and the blue tones. As the cheese matures it develops a fudgy-like texture which melts on the tongue. Perl Las is also available as a full-size cheese, for extra party wow factor - see separate listing or call the shop to order. As Perl Las is made with vegetarian rennet it is suitable for vegetarians.Cows' milk, pasteurised, vegetarian.

Hafod  – Made by the Holden Family in WalesThe recipe for the cheese originated locally, from the late Dougal Campbell, a close friend of Patrick’s. Dougal learned to make cheese in the Swiss Alps before moving to West Wales in the early 1980s. Here he started making a cheese called T’yn Grug using milk from both his own herd and ours. Whilst doing so, Dougal trained a number of cheesemakers, including Simon Jones of Lincolnshire Poacher.
